Lubuto Library Project Talk in Washington DC

To bring literacy and hope to Africa’s vulnerable children, Jane Kinney Meyers founded the Lubuto Library Project. Meyers will discuss the goals and accomplishments of the project at the Library of Congress at noon on Wednesday, Dec. 3 in the Pickford Theater, located on the third floor of the James Madison Building at 101 Independence Ave. S.E., Washington, D.C. The lecture, sponsored by the African Section of the Library’s African and Middle Eastern Division, is free and open to the public. Tickets are not required.
